diff options
author | bors-servo <lbergstrom+bors@mozilla.com> | 2016-02-19 03:14:28 +0530 |
---|---|---|
committer | bors-servo <lbergstrom+bors@mozilla.com> | 2016-02-19 03:14:28 +0530 |
commit | 2374e9d30e015884e87305006ac61a77b7efd5ee (patch) | |
tree | 2076544187a54ed7262de2dbe7bd32ef305ea438 /components/script/dom/virtualmethods.rs | |
parent | 96d185359d78e82d2f41a56a1793f7e657c2d103 (diff) | |
parent | 4bb5cd1285ebceb9d2baca432995ab8f09648ba3 (diff) | |
download | servo-2374e9d30e015884e87305006ac61a77b7efd5ee.tar.gz servo-2374e9d30e015884e87305006ac61a77b7efd5ee.zip |
Auto merge of #9526 - schuster:node-remove, r=nox
My updates so far for issue #8465. See comments there for more information.
<!-- Reviewable:start -->
[<img src="https://reviewable.io/review_button.svg" height="40" alt="Review on Reviewable"/>](https://reviewable.io/reviews/servo/servo/9526)
<!-- Reviewable:end -->
Diffstat (limited to 'components/script/dom/virtualmethods.rs')
-rw-r--r-- | components/script/dom/virtualmethods.rs |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/components/script/dom/virtualmethods.rs b/components/script/dom/virtualmethods.rs index 2e8391671a8..e3def582ae4 100644 --- a/components/script/dom/virtualmethods.rs +++ b/components/script/dom/virtualmethods.rs @@ -83,6 +83,8 @@ pub trait VirtualMethods { /// Called when a Node is removed from a tree, where 'tree_in_doc' /// indicates whether the tree is part of a Document. + /// Implements removing steps: + /// https://dom.spec.whatwg.org/#concept-node-remove-ext fn unbind_from_tree(&self, context: &UnbindContext) { if let Some(ref s) = self.super_type() { s.unbind_from_tree(context); |